Planning permission for nine telegraph poles in Peel will be the subject of five questions in the House of Keys next week.
When MHKs gather, Glenfaba and Peel MHK Kate Lord-Brennan will raise the subject with Environment, Food and Agriculture Minister Clare Barber.
She wants to know about the planning process which allowed Manx Telecom to put up the poles in Belle Vue Park and Cronk Rearyt.
The House of Keys is due to sit from 10am on Tuesday, June 9 in Legislative Buildings in Douglas.
